North Korea Presumably Launches Ballistic Missile - Japanese Coast Guards


(MENAFN- Trend News Agency) North Korea launched what is presumed to be a ballistic missile on Sunday, Japanese coast guards reported, trend reports citing tass .

Vessels in the region were advised to stay away from potential debris and immediately contact the authorities if they come across any of them.

The previous launch took place just three days ago, on March 16. It was North Korea's eighth missile test this year.
